The conversation delves into the proven hypothesis trap, the challenges of solving the scheduling problem, the pivotal moment of pivoting the business, and the strategy of building in public. Jing Jing shares insights on the pitfalls of assuming a proven hypothesis, the complexities of scheduling solutions, the need for pivoting to address customer needs, and the benefits of building a business in public.
